October 5 - Hollywood’s Black Friday

On this day in Labor History the year was 1945.  That was a day known as in Hollywood “Black Friday.”  After World War II, the movie industry began to rake in profits.  But they did not pass those on to their employees. 10,000 members of the Conference of Studio Unions, were on strike.  They were part of the Brotherhood of Carpenters and Joiners.  They were also in a jurisdictional battle with the International Alliance of Theatrical Stage Employees, or IATSE, over who should represen...
